Behavioral responses of adult female tobacco hornworms, Manduca sexta, to hostplant volatiles change with age and mating status

open access: yesJournal of Insect Science, 2002
We present evidence for two behaviors influenced by intact, vegetative plant odor -- upwind flight and abdomen curling -- in female Manduca sexta and demonstrate the influence of the age and mating status of the moths on these behaviors.

Vacuum–Laser Fabrication of Programmable Soft Actuators

open access: yesAdvanced Science, EarlyView.
A rapid and accessible fabrication strategy for inflatable soft actuators is presented, combining vacuum sealing with laser cutting of low‐cost thermoplastic pouches. The method enables precise sealing, fast fabrication, and programmable multi‐cell geometries.

Breaking the Toughness‐Stretchability Trade‐Off in Hydrogels with Dynamic Hydrogen Bonding

open access: yesAdvanced Science, EarlyView.
A novel nanocomposite hydrogel architecture overcomes the inherent conflict between toughness and stretchability by integrating uniformly dispersed aminopropyl‐hybrid‐phyllosilicate nanosheets within a polyacrylamide matrix. This design leverages a dynamic hydrogen‐bonding network to facilitate efficient energy dissipation and self‐recovery.

Realization of a Bilayer Elastic Topological Insulator

open access: yesAdvanced Science, EarlyView.
Bilayer elastic wave topological insulators are experimentally realized, introducing the layer degree of freedom to access four topological phases. This enables diverse domain walls and transmission behaviors, including interlayer conversion and beam splitting.

Stimulus‐Induced Self‐Reinforcement in Supramolecular Bamboo Plastics toward Mechanical Robustness and Programmable Shapeability

open access: yesAdvanced Science, EarlyView.
A self‐reinforcement strategy is reported for the fabrication of bamboo plastics utilizing ethanol to induce the supramolecular network reconstruction of cellulose and polyacrylamide molecules. These bamboo plastics exhibit high mechanical strength, excellent thermal stability, resistance to low temperatures, and controllable shapeability.
